Job Tile: 3D Production Artist Duration: 12+ Months Job Description: We are seeking a detail-oriented and hilly skilled Production Artist with experience in 3D asset post-processing to join our team in the digital preservation and production of high-fidelity 3D assets. In this role, you will take raw 3D scan data-captured from high-resolution scanning devices- and transform it into clean, production-ready 3D assets. This includes geometry cleanup, optimization, and texture retouching using Adobe Substance tools within a PBR (physically-Based rendering) workflow. Key responsibilities: Import and process raw 3d data to prepare it for use in real-time or high-fidelity rendering environments. Clean and optimize geometry. Refine textures using Adobe Substance 3d tools following a physically based rendering (PBR) Workflow. Ensure materials and assets are visually consistent, photorealistic and performant for target platforms (High-fidelity Archival and Optimized for real-time Web, AR,VR) Work closely with 3d Scanning operator and Archivists. Maintain organized file structures and naming conventions for efficient asset management. Required skills & Qualifications: Proven experience working with 3d Scanned data and post-processing for production. Proficient in Adobe Substance 3d Painter and other Substance tools. Strong understanding of PBR material workflows and real-time rendering pipelines. Proficient with 3d modeling tools such as Blender. Experience with retopology, UV mapping, and normal baking. Familiarity with real-time rendering engines is a plus. Strong artistic eye and attention to detail, especially for material surface qualities and realism. Ability to work independently in a fast-paced production environment. Preferred qualifications: Background in digital art, VFX, 3d production. Experience with photogrammetry pipelines and automated scan processing tools. Knowledge of color calibration and photographic reference processing is a plus. This in-office requirement may be adjusted at the discretion of the company.Apparel Textile Production ArtistJob Summary As our Textile Production Artist, you will collaborate with the Apparel Textile Design team to translate print and yarn-dye artwork into development packages for fabric mills. This role requires strong technical skills in creating repeats, color separations, and artwork packages, combined with organizational ability and calendar awareness to meet seasonal deadlines. You'll ensure designs are producible, troubleshoot artwork issues, and participate in strike-off reviews to maintain quality and accuracy. Responsibilities Create textile artwork production packages and schematics, including repeats and color separations. Collaborate with cross functional partners to ensure designs meet specifications. Troubleshoot artwork and production issues; propose alternative printing or color techniques as needed. Participate in strike-off review and approval; track incoming strike-offs and manage seasonal tracker. Provide input on department processes and best practices for efficiency and first-time-right outcomes. Support department training and create visual tools for design waypoints. Qualifications Bachelor's degree or equivalent experience in apparel design, fabric arts, graphic design, or related field. 2-4 years in design/apparel industry with prior textile artwork production experience. Proficiency in Adobe Illustrator and Photoshop; strong repeat creation and color separation skills. Ability to review strike-off colorways against standards; strong organizational and communication skills. Self-managed, detail-oriented, and able to work under pressure. How much does a graphic artist earn in Beaverton, OR?

The average graphic artist in Beaverton, OR earns between $46,000 and $113,000 annually. This compares to the national average graphic artist range of $35,000 to $84,000.

Average graphic artist salary in Beaverton, OR

$72,000
